Bihar Police BPSSC ASI (Operation) Recruitment 2026: Apply Online for 462 Assistant Sub-Inspector Posts
Bihar Police BPSSC Assistant Sub Inspector (ASI) Operation Recruitment 2026 - Apply Online for 462 Vacancies
Bihar Police Subordinate Services Commission (BPSSC) has officially released Advertisement No. 04/2026 for the recruitment of Assistant Sub-Inspector (Operation) in Bihar Police Radio (Wireless) Department. This BPSSC ASI Operation recruitment 2026 aims to fill 462 vacancies for wireless communication operations in Bihar Police. Eligible candidates can apply online through the official BPSSC portal from 04 February 2026 to 04 March 2026. Eligibility Criteria for BPSSC ASI Operation

A. Educational Qualification (as on 01/08/2025):

  • Essential: Bachelor's Degree in B.Sc with Physics as a subject from a recognized university.
  • Minimum Marks: 50% aggregate marks for General/EWS/OBC candidates.
  • Minimum Marks for Reserved: 45% aggregate marks for SC/ST candidates.

B. Age Limit (as on 01/08/2025):

CategoryMinimum AgeMaximum Age
Male Candidates21 Years37 Years
Female Candidates40 Years

C. Physical Standards:

Physical ParameterMale CandidatesFemale Candidates
Height165 cm (160 cm for SC/ST)155 cm
Chest (Male Only)81-86 cm (79-84 cm for SC/ST)Not Applicable
Running Test1.6 km in 7 minutes1 km in 7 minutes
High Jump3 feet 6 inches2 feet 6 inches
Long Jump10 feet7 feet
Shot Put (Gola Fek)16 pound through 14 feet12 pound through 8 feet

Important: Age relaxation will be provided as per Bihar Government rules. Refer to official notification for detailed age relaxation details.

BPSSC ASI Operation 2026: Selection Process
  1. Written Examination: Objective type MCQs covering General Knowledge, Physics, Mathematics, and Reasoning.
  2. Physical Measurement Test (PMT): Height and Chest measurement verification.
  3. Physical Efficiency Test (PET): Running, Jumping, and Shot Put tests as per prescribed standards.
  4. Document Verification: Original documents verification for shortlisted candidates.
  5. Final Merit List: Based on written exam marks (80%) and PET/PMT qualifying status (20%).
BPSSC ASI Operation 2026: Exam Pattern
SubjectNumber of QuestionsMarksDuration
General Knowledge & Current Affairs501002 Hours (120 Minutes)
Physics (B.Sc Level)50100
Mathematics2550
Logical Reasoning & Mental Ability2550
Total150 Questions300 Marks120 Minutes

Marking Scheme: Each correct answer carries 2 marks. There is no negative marking for wrong answers.

Career Scope & Growth Opportunities

Bihar Police Assistant Sub-Inspector (Operation) in Radio Wireless department offers a prestigious career with excellent growth prospects. Selected candidates will undergo specialized training in wireless communication technology at Bihar Police Training Academy. After training, ASI (Operation) will be responsible for managing wireless communication networks, maintaining radio equipment, and ensuring secure communication for police operations across Bihar.

Promotional Avenues: ASI (Operation) can be promoted to Sub-Inspector (SI), Inspector, and higher ranks through departmental examinations and seniority. There are opportunities for specialized training in advanced communication technologies and cyber security.

Salary & Benefits: As per 7th Pay Commission, the pay scale for ASI (Operation) is Level 5 (₹29,200 - ₹92,300) plus grade pay, allowances (DA, HRA, TA), medical benefits, pension, and other government perks as per Bihar Police rules.
